Heat- & Oil-Resistant Rubber Conveyor Belt Multi-Ply for Hot Oily Materials Temperoilgum

Oil gum

Oil-resistant rubber belts by Monster Belting are used for handling oily materials at temperatures not exceeding 80°C, and they have smooth covers.

These rubber belts made of several plies, are coated with elastomers that are highly oil resistant and made to withstand contact with any type of oily or greasy material; they are also resistant to aromatic and aliphatic solvents, as well as wear due to rubbing and cutting; they can be successfully used at temperatures ranging from– 20º to +80ºC. They are ideal for transporting oil seeds, petroleum coke, urban wastes, additional fossils, fertilizers, and lubricated metal parts.

Technical characteristic

  • Number of Plies EP: from 2 to 4.
  • Rubber covers top and bottom; oil resistant.
  • Top-cover surface type: smooth.
  • Working temperature: -20/+80°C.
  • Remarks: rubber belt made to withstand contact with oily or greasy materials.

Temperoilgum

Monster belting |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belts for Chemical and Petroleum Industries

These rubber belts, made of several plies, are covered with polyvalent material for contact with oily and hot products in an outdoor environment, with abrasive action, and risk of cutting and tears due to the mechanical effects of the transported materials at temperatures of 110ºC with peaks up to 130ºC.

Monster belting |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belts for Chemical and Petroleum Industries

Technical characteristic

  • Number of plies EP: from 2 to 4.
  • Rubber covers: top and bottom, oil resistant and heat resistant.
  • Top-cover surface type: smooth.
  • Working temperature: -20/+110-130°C.
  • Remarks: these rubber belt are oil resistant and suitable for trasport of hot material.

What Are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belts?

Definition and unique characteristics

An oil-resistant conveyor belt is designed to withstand prolonged exposure to oily and greasy materials without compromising performance. These belts are formulated with specific compounds to block oil absorption.

Oil-resistant rubber compounds and construction materials

These belts use nitrile rubber, neoprene, or oil-treated SBR for enhanced resistance. Reinforcements like polyester or nylon layers add structural integrity and load-handling capability.

Difference between MOR (Moderate Oil Resistance) and OR (High Oil Resistance)

MOR belts are suitable for occasional oil contact, whereas OR belts are designed for continuous and intense oil exposure, typical in the chemical and petroleum sectors.

Properties/Quality Values of Conveyor Belt Covers

Cover Designation

Mechanical Stressing

Chemical Stressing (Oil/Grease)

Tear Resistance (N/mm²)

Elongation at Tear (%)

Abrasion (mm³)

Permitted Temp. Range (°C)

Max. Swelling in ASTM Oil 3 (20°C, % vol.)

Main Polymer

Special Properties

OIL GM + O 19 500 110 -30 to +70 60 NBR/SBR
OIL + 17 600 170 -20 to +125 5 NBR Withstands temps up to 130°C
OIL GMS + O 18 460 140 -25 to +70 40 NBR/SBR Flame retardant (EN 20340/EN 12682)
OIL GS + 19 500 230 -15 to +120 5 NBR Flame retardant (EN 20340/EN 12682)

 

 

 

OIL QY ++ ++ 23 650 130 -15 to +90 3 NBR Resistant to cuts and abrasion
OIL GA O ++ 10 600 300 -20 to +140 3 NBR Light-color, food-safe (BGA 21), withstands 140°C
OIL GR + O 19 600 85 -50 to +90 60 NBR Suitable for low temperatures
OIL QV O 10 300 250 -15 to +200 60 EAM Halogen-free, low fuming, high-temp resistant, flame-retardant

Symbols & Abbreviations:

  • Mechanical/Chemical Stressing:
  • ++ = Excellent, + = Good, O = Moderate, = Not Recommended
  • Polymers:
    • NBR: Nitrile Butadiene Rubber (oil-resistant)
    • SBR: Styrene Butadiene Rubber (general-purpose)
    • EAM: Ethylene-Acrylic Elastomer (high-temp resistant)
  • Standards:
    • EN 20340/EN 12682: Flame-retardant certification
    • BGA 21: German food safety guideline

Performance Summary:

  • Best Oil Resistance: OIL QY (lowest swelling: 3%)
  • Highest Temp. Resistance: OIL QV (up to 200°C)
  • Best Abrasion Resistance: OIL QY (130 mm³)
  • Food-Grade Option: OIL GA (light-colored, BGA-compliant)

Note: All values are based on ISO/DIN standards. Select cover type based on application-specific requirements (e.g., oil exposure, temperature extremes)

Here’s the professionally organized specification table for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belts:

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belt Characteristics

Conveyor Type

Standard

Temperature Range

Resistance to Oil

Carcass Composition

Cover Composition

ROS DIN 22102/1-91 G -30°C to +100°C Excellent resistance to oils and greases NBR + SBR NBR
G DIN 22102/1-91 G -30°C to +80°C Good oil resistance SBR + NBR NBR + SBR
GM DIN 22102/1-91 G -30°C to +70°C Medium oil resistance SBR NBR + SBR

 

 

Technical data:

  1. Performance Comparison:
    1. ROS: Highest oil resistance (NBR cover) and widest temp range (-30°C to +100°C)
    2. G: Balanced oil resistance with mixed polymer (NBR+SBR) construction
    3. GM: Basic oil resistance with SBR carcass for cost-effective solutions
  2. Material Composition:
    1. NBR (Nitrile Rubber): Primary oil-resistant component
    2. SBR (Styrene Butadiene Rubber): Provides general durability
  3. Application Guidance:
    1. ROS: Heavy oil/grease exposure (e.g., automotive, machining)
    2. G: Moderate oil environments (e.g., food processing, packaging)
    3. GM: Light oil contact (e.g., general material handling)
  4. Standards Compliance:
    1. All types certified under DIN 22102/1-91 G (German industrial standard for conveyor belts)

Selection Criteria:

  • For high-temperature oil resistance (>100°C), consider specialty compounds beyond this range
  • Carcass composition affects flexibility and load capacity
  • Cover composition determines surface oil resistance

Comparing Oil-Resistant Materials: Nitrile vs. Neoprene vs. SBR

Material breakdown: strengths and tradeoffs

Nitrile offers top-tier oil resistance but at a higher cost. Neoprene balances flexibility and chemical resistance. SBR is economical but less resistant.

Monster belting | Oil-Resistant Conveyor Belts for Chemical and Petroleum Industries

Suitability for different chemical environments

Nitrile excels in petrochemical settings, Neoprene in mixed environments, and SBR in low-exposure areas.

Which belt materials last longer under industrial solvents?

Nitrile belts typically outlast others under intense solvent exposure due to superior impermeability.
